Simplifying 5x + 2y = 750 Solving 5x + 2y = 750 Solving for variable 'x'. Move all terms containing x to the left, all other terms to the right. Add '-2y' to each side of the equation. 5x + 2y + -2y = 750 + -2y Combine like terms: 2y + -2y = 0 5x + 0 = 750 + -2y 5x = 750 + -2y Divide each side by '5'. x = 150 + -0.4y Simplifying x = 150 + -0.4y
